I came, I saw, I conquered in Greek

I came, I saw, I conquered in Greek is ήλθον, είδον, ενίκησα.

I came, I saw, I conquered in Greek

ήλθον, είδον, ενίκησα
phrase
Pronounced: ilthon, eidon, enikisa
I have gained a total and swift victory.
